Presidential Gold Coins
The United States Mint began providing Presidential $1 coins in 2007. This series honors previous United States presidents. They are golden colored and feature a portrait of the former president on the obverse and a picture of the Statue of Liberty on the reverse. A motto, “IN GOD WE TRUST”, is inscribed on the edge of these coins.
These coins are indicated to be used in vending devices, parking meters, and other locations where they can be bought. The Federal Reserve Banks distribute the coins to their members, banks, and credit unions.

The very first coin to be issued under the Presidential $1 Coin Act was the George Washington coin. It was released two weeks before the John Adams coin was released.
This was the first in a series of 4 one dollar coins to be issued each year. The designs on these coins have altered over time.
